Background
AEBS (Advanced Emergency Braking System), Advanced Emergency Braking System. I.e., a composite of ABS and AEB. The AEB detects obstacles in front and back of the vehicle by using the eagle eye and the cat eye, gives an alarm through a series of internal program operations, and transmits a brake signal to the ABS control system to automatically brake under the condition that a driver does not actively brake. The AEBS is an autonomous, automated road vehicle safety system that calculates an impending condition by monitoring the relative speed and distance between the leading vehicle and the detecting and target vehicles with sensors. In the case of a dangerous situation, the collision can be automatically avoided or the influence thereof can be reduced during emergency braking. In the existing AEBS executing mechanism, after the anchor fixing device is installed and fixed, when the moving part is pulled to move by the pulling part connected with the anchor fixing device, the pulling part cannot rotate to adjust the angle between the pulling part and the moving part.

Detailed Description
The preferred embodiments of the present invention will be described in conjunction with the accompanying drawings, and it will be understood that they are presented herein only to illustrate and explain the present invention, and not to limit the present invention.
The embodiment of the utility model provides an AEBS actuating mechanism universal lower margin fixing device, including gyration fixing base 3 and rotation mechanism, the gyration is connected with the revolving axle on the gyration fixing base 3, rotation mechanism includes: the casing 5, the casing 5 is installed on the revolving axle, be provided with pulley 4 in the casing 5, pulley 4 center is equipped with pivot 41, pivot 41 both ends respectively fixed connection be in 5 both ends of casing, wire rope 2 winding on pulley 4 and pulley 4 revolute the rotation of rotation shaft 41 and can receive and release wire rope 2, the both ends of casing 5 perpendicular to 41 directions of rotation shaft are equipped with the confession the hole of wearing out that 2 both ends of wire rope worn out, and wire rope first end 21 fixedly connected with can open or closed hasp 1, and wire rope second end 22 is connected with the motor.
The working principle and the beneficial effects of the technical scheme are as follows: when the utility model is used, the rotary fixed seat 3 is fixedly arranged in the vehicle body, the first end 21 of the steel wire rope is connected with the motor, the second end 22 of the steel wire rope is connected with a moving part which needs to move through the control of the motor through the lock catch 1, the steel wire rope 2 can be collected and released through the design of the pulley 4 structure, thereby the length of the steel wire rope 2 extending out of the shell 5 can be adjusted to the tension steel wire rope 2 when the device is installed and used, the steel wire rope 2 can be tensioned, the movement of the moving part pulled through the motor and the steel wire rope 2 is accurate, through the design of the rotary shaft, the shell 5 can rotate 360 degrees around the rotary shaft, thereby the steel wire rope 2 in the shell 5 can rotate 360 degrees around the rotary shaft, when the device is used, under the condition that, the angle between the steel wire rope 2 and the moving part of the moving part is adjusted, and the steel wire rope 2 can be adjusted to be vertical to the moving part of the moving part, so that the requirement of the moving track is met, the steel wire rope 2 can be flexibly adjusted in a rotating manner, the steel wire rope 2 is prevented from being damaged or broken, the service life of the steel wire rope 2 is prolonged, the movement is accurately controlled, and the use safety is improved; and the structure is convenient for mounting various steel wire ropes 2, can be applied to vehicles with different steel wire ropes 2, and has wide application.
In one embodiment, the openable or closable lock 1 includes a lock body 13, one end of the lock body 13 is provided with a hook 131, one end of a locking ring 14 is hinged to the other end of the lock body 13 through a first hinge axis, a spring is provided at the hinge, two ends of the spring are respectively abutted against the lock body and the locking ring, the other end of the locking ring 14 can be in contact with the hook 131 to close the lock 1, the other end of the locking ring 14 has a tendency to be out of contact with the hook 131 to rotate the locking ring 14 towards the lock 1 to open the lock 1, and the other end of the lock 1 is further provided with a wire rope mounting hole 1131 for connecting a wire rope 2.
The working principle and the beneficial effects of the technical scheme are as follows: the lock catch 1 is simple in structure, the lock catch 1 can be opened or closed by rotating the locking ring 14, the lock catch 1 is convenient to open or close, and the steel wire rope 2 is simple to connect.
in one embodiment, the openable or closable lock catch 1 includes:
The clamp ring 11 is provided with an opening, one end of the opening side is a first hinge portion 111, the other end of the opening side is a first clamping portion 112, a first connecting portion 113 extends from the clamp ring 11 close to the first hinge portion 111, and the first connecting portion 113 is provided with a steel wire rope mounting hole 1131 for connecting a steel wire rope 2;
The elastic strip 12 has a second hinge 121 and a second engaging portion 122 at two ends of the elastic strip 12 in the length direction, the second hinge 121 is hinged to the first hinge 111, the second engaging portion 122 is in close contact with the first engaging portion 112 inside and outside and closes the opening, and the second engaging portion 122 has a tendency to disengage from the first engaging portion 112 so that the elastic strip 12 rotates toward the clasp 11 along the hinged portion; when the elastic clamp is used, inward pushing force is applied to the strip-shaped elastic sheet 12, the strip-shaped elastic sheet 12 rotates towards the clamping ring 11 along the hinged position, and the second clamping portion 122 is separated from the first clamping portion 112 to be in close contact with the first clamping portion, so that the opening is opened.
The working principle and the beneficial effects of the technical scheme are as follows: the working principle and the beneficial effects of the technical scheme are as follows:
In the normally closed state, under the action of the self stress of the strip-shaped elastic sheet 12, the second clamping portion 122 of the strip-shaped elastic sheet 12 abuts against the end portion of the first clamping portion 112 of the snap ring 11 and is in a normally closed position, so that the opening of the snap ring 11 is closed; in the opening state, an inward thrust is applied to the strip-shaped elastic sheet 12, the strip-shaped elastic sheet 12 rotates towards the snap ring 11 along the hinged part, and the second clamping part 122 is separated from the first clamping part 112 to be in close contact with the snap ring 11, so that the opening of the snap ring 11 is opened; the lock catch 1 is convenient to open and close, and the closed lock catch 1 is reliable.
in one embodiment, the bar-shaped elastic piece 12 includes a first end rod 124, a second end rod 123 and a second connecting portion 1221, one end of the first end rod 124 is connected to one end of the second end rod 123 through the second connecting portion 1221, and the other end of the first end rod 124 is provided with a second hinge shaft 125 facing the other end of the second end rod 123 and not contacting the other end of the second end rod 123.
The working principle and the beneficial effects of the technical scheme are as follows: the second connection portion 1221 (i.e., the specific structure of the second engaging portion 122) is conveniently disposed to engage with or open from the first engaging portion 112, and is conveniently hinged by the second hinge shaft 125, and the connection is reliable.
in one embodiment, the first engaging portion of the snap ring 11 is provided with a locking groove 1121 which is matched with the second connecting portion 1221.
The working principle and the beneficial effects of the technical scheme are as follows: the provision of the clamping groove 1121 facilitates the first engaging portion 112 of the snap ring 11 to be engaged with or disengaged from the second connecting portion 1221 of the strip-shaped elastic piece 12 (i.e., the specific structure of the second engaging portion 122), and the engagement and positioning are reliable.
in one embodiment, the connection end of the steel wire rope 2 and the motor is further connected with a fine adjustment mechanism 6, and the fine adjustment mechanism 6 includes: guide sleeve 61, adjusting nut 62, adjusting screw 63, the hole outside is worn out at the casing 5 that is close to motor one end to guide sleeve 61 fixed connection, guide sleeve 61 is equipped with the internal thread, adjusting screw 63's external screw thread with interior screw-thread fit, still be connected with on the external screw thread with exterior screw-thread fit's adjusting nut 62, adjusting screw 63 fixed connection be in on the wire rope 2.
The working principle and the beneficial effects of the technical scheme are as follows: set up guide sleeve 61, and adopt adjusting screw 63 with guide sleeve 61 threaded connection, adjusting screw 63 fixes on wire rope 2, this structure has the guide effect when adjusting wire rope 2 extension length, make wire rope 2 along guide sleeve 61, adjusting screw 63 orientation receive and releases, during the use, accessible rotates adjusting screw 63 and finely tunes wire rope 2 extension casing 5 outer length, adopt adjusting nut 62 locking after the fine setting is accomplished, it is fixed to make wire rope 2 extend casing 5 outer length, it makes wire rope 2 taut to conveniently adjust suitable length, and convenient operation when using this structure to finely tune and lock wire rope 2 extension casing 5 outer length, locking is reliable.
In one embodiment, the end of the adjusting screw 63 away from the guiding sleeve 61 is provided with a rotating sleeve 64 integrally formed with the adjusting screw 63, and the rotating sleeve 64 is provided with a plurality of grooves along the axial direction.
the working principle and the beneficial effects of the technical scheme are as follows: the connection is reliable in integral forming, and the rotating sleeve 64 is provided with a plurality of grooves along the axial direction, so that a user can operate the rotating sleeve 64 to finely adjust the length of the steel wire rope 2 extending out of the shell 5.
in one embodiment, the guide sleeve 61 is welded to the housing 5.
The working principle and the beneficial effects of the technical scheme are as follows: the welding connection is firm and reliable.
in one embodiment, the rotary fixing base 3 is provided with a mounting hole 31 for mounting the rotary fixing base 3 on the inner wall of the vehicle near the brake pedal.
The working principle and the beneficial effects of the technical scheme are as follows: the installation hole is formed for installing the rotary fixing seat 3 on the inner wall of the vehicle close to the brake pedal in the vehicle, so that the rotary fixing seat can be conveniently combined with other related vehicle components such as the brake pedal.
In one embodiment, a bearing 7 is fixed in the rotary fixing seat 3, a bearing inner ring 72 of the bearing 7 is connected with the rotary shaft, and the bearing 7 includes:
1 bearing outer ring 71;
A plurality of U-shaped brackets 73, wherein the plurality of U-shaped brackets 73 are welded on the inner side wall surface of the bearing outer ring 71;
A plurality of first gears 74, wherein each first gear 74 is sleeved on one U-shaped bracket 73;
1 bearing inner ring 72, wherein the outer side wall surface of the bearing inner ring 72 is provided with a thread meshed with the first gear 74;
Annular grooves are formed in the inner side wall surface of the bearing outer ring 71 and located on two sides of the U-shaped support 73, a pair of circular grooves corresponding in position are formed in the inner wall surface of each annular groove, circular racks 75 are welded to the upper wall surface and the lower wall surface of each circular groove, a plurality of connecting rods 76 are assembled in the pair of circular grooves corresponding in position, and a pair of second gears 77 meshed with the circular racks 75 are sleeved on the outer side wall surface of each connecting rod 76.
The working principle and the beneficial effects of the technical scheme are as follows: the U-shaped bracket 73 arranged in the bearing outer ring 71 plays a supporting role and is used for supporting the first gear 74, the first gear 74 is meshed with the threads on the outer wall surface of the bearing inner ring 72, so that the first gear 74 can roll on the bearing inner ring 72 conveniently, and the connecting rod 76 can rotate on the bearing outer ring 71 for 360 degrees conveniently by the fact that the circular rack 75 arranged in the first circular groove formed in the first annular groove is meshed with the second gear 77 supported by the connecting rod 76. Use the ball to compare with current rolling bearing, the ball installation is troublesome, and drops easily, influences the use, and the utility model discloses a gear engagement has installation convenient operation, stable in structure, long service life's advantage.
